Steps to Change Instagram Password on iPhone
Now, for the pièce de rĂ©sistance! Here’s How To Change your Instagram Password On your iPhone:
Step | Description |
---|---|
Open Instagram app | Launch the app on your iPhone. |
Tap on your profile | Access your profile by tapping your profile picture. |
Tap on the three horizontal lines | Located in the top right corner, tap these lines. |
Navigate to ‘Settings’ | In the menu, find and select ‘Settings.’ |
Go to ‘Security’ | Under ‘Settings,’ go to ‘Security.’ |
Access ‘Password’ | In the ‘Security’ section, tap on ‘Password.’ |
Enter a current and new password | You’ll be prompted to enter your current and new passwords. |
Confirm the new password | Confirm the new password to finalize the change. |
- Fire up your Instagram app and head straight to your profile. You’ll see those three horizontal lines at the top right—tap on them.
- A menu will pop up. Navigate to ‘Settings’. It’s like the control room of your Instagram account.
- Once you’re in ‘Settings’, go to ‘Security’. From there, it’s a straight path to ‘Password’.
- You’ll be prompted to enter your current password (hopefully, it’s not “123456”). After that, type in your new, super-secure password. Confirm it, and voilĂ ! Your Instagram account just got a security upgrade.

Additional Security Measures on Instagram
In the bustling digital bazaar that is Instagram, it’s not just about posting that perfect sunset picture or the mouth-watering brunch you had. It’s also about ensuring that your account is Fort Knox-level secure. And while a strong password is the first line of defense, there are other knights in shining armor you should be aware of.
Security Measure | Description |
---|---|
Two-factor authentication | Enable 2FA in settings for an extra layer of security. |
Regular account activity check | Keep an eye on your account activity; report suspicious behavior. |
Beware of third-party apps | Review and manage app permissions to avoid unauthorized access. |
Ever heard of two-factor authentication? Think of it as a double-check for your account’s security. When enabled, you’ll receive a code on your phone every time you log in. It’s like having a secret handshake with Instagram. To enable it, head to your settings, tap on ‘Security’, and then ‘Two-factor authentication’. Easy peasy!
But wait, there’s more! Regularly reviewing your account activity can be a game-changer. If you spot any suspicious behavior, like posts you didn’t make or messages you didn’t send, it’s time to raise the alarm.
Lastly, be wary of third-party apps. While some might promise you the moon and stars (or more followers), they might be wolves in sheep’s clothing. Always manage and review app permissions to ensure you’re not giving away the keys to your kingdom.
Recovering Your Instagram Account
Oops! Locked out of your account? Don’t panic. Instagram has got your back. Here’s what you need to do:
- On the login page, tap ‘Forgot password’.
- Follow the prompts, and you’ll be sent a link to reset your password.
- If all else fails, contacting Instagram support is your best bet. They’re like the superheroes of the digital realm, always ready to help.
Remember, prevention is better than cure. Linking an email and phone number to your account is like having a safety net. If you ever get locked out, Instagram can send recovery information to get you back in action.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I change my Instagram password on my iPhone?
To change your Instagram password on your iPhone, navigate to your profile, tap on the three lines, select ‘Settings’, then ‘Security’, and finally ‘Password’. Follow the prompts to complete the change.
Why can’t I change my Instagram password on my iPhone?
If you’re unable to change your Instagram password on your iPhone, it could be due to a weak internet connection, an outdated app version, or temporary server issues. Ensure your app is updated and try again.
How often should I update my Instagram password on my iPhone?
It’s recommended to update your Instagram password on your iPhone every 3-6 months. Regular changes enhance security and reduce the risk of unauthorized access.
What should I do if I forget my Instagram password on my iPhone?
If you forget your Instagram password on your iPhone, tap on ‘Forgot password’ on the login page. Follow the instructions to reset it using your email or phone number.
Is it safe to use third-party apps to change my Instagram password on my iPhone?
It’s always best to avoid third-party apps when dealing with password changes. Use the official Instagram app on your iPhone to ensure maximum security.
How can I make my Instagram password stronger on my iPhone?
To make your Instagram password stronger on your iPhone, combine u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special symbols. Avoid using easily guessable information like birthdays.
Can I set up two-factor authentication on the iPhone for added security?
Yes, you can set up two-factor authentication on your iPhone for Instagram. It provides an extra layer of security by requiring a code sent to your phone during login.
